1. The Birth of Computer Systems
The journey of computer systems began with the development of the first mechanical calculators and punch-card machines in the 19th century. However, it was the invention of the electronic computer in the mid-20th century that paved the way for the digital revolution. Early computers like ENIAC and UNIVAC laid the groundwork for the computation power that drives today’s digital age.

Technical SEO (https://delante.co/technical-seo-services/) refers to the optimization of your website’s technical elements to enhance its visibility and performance on search engines like Google. Unlike traditional SEO, which focuses on content and keywords, technical SEO concentrates on the behind-the-scenes aspects that influence how search engines crawl, index, and rank your site.
The Significance of Technical SEO
Technical SEO forms the backbone of a successful digital marketing strategy. Here’s why it’s crucial:
- Improved Crawling: Optimized technical elements ensure that search engine bots can efficiently crawl your site, discovering and indexing your content faster.
- Enhanced User Experience: Technical SEO enhances site speed and mobile-friendliness, leading to a better user experience and lower bounce rates.
- Higher Rankings: A well-optimized website is more likely to rank higher in search engine results pages (SERPs), increasing organic traffic.

Reducing Volatile Organic Compounds (VOCs) with Powder Coating Booths
Traditional liquid paints often produce Volatile Organic Compounds (VOCs) during the application and curing process. These compounds contribute significantly to air pollution and are associated with various health issues. By contrast, powder coatings contain no solvents and emit negligible amounts of VOCs. Thus, by upgrading to a state-of-the-art powder coating booth, industries can dramatically reduce their environmental footprint while ensuring workers’ safety.

Automating Efficiency: The Rise of Robotic Paint Spray Booths
Automation is at the forefront of the paint spray booth revolution. Robotic paint spray booths are garnering significant attention for their ability to streamline the painting process and deliver consistent, high-quality results. Equipped with advanced sensors and programmable logic controllers (PLCs), these robots can precisely control the spray pattern, ensuring uniform coverage and minimal overspray.
